Fairbanks Residents Overwhelm Clinic with Swine Flu Worries

The Tanana Valley Clinic in Fairbanks is being overwhelmed with sick people wanting to be tested and treated for H1N1 or Swine flu. Chief medical officer Dr. Hunter Judkins says T.V.C.’s first care clinic saw a record 123 patients Tuesday.
